Slander – The 9 members of the Comisión Nacional Anticorrupción (CNA) were the subjects of a slander complaint filed by the Carlos Pólit, the Comptroller General. The commissioners were sentenced yesterday to a year in jail, a $100,000 fine for each individual, and a public apology.  The CNA had found negligence and possible bribery in the land purchase for the Refinería del Pacífico.  <uh-oh – and the comptroller didn’t catch it?>  After a public appeal by Pres. elect Moreno, Pólit withdrew the criminal action.  <Maybe the fact that one of the commissioners is a 99 year old woman in a wheelchair, and the others are all over 65 was a factor?>

Credentials – The CNE started delivering credentials to the assemblists who were elected on 19/2.  The official results include 74 seats for AP out of a possible 137, 34 for CREO-SUMA, 15 for PSC (Partido Social Cristiano <Viteri’s party>) and 4 for Pachakutic, the indigenous movement.

Tortugas gigantes – 190 giant tortoises who were raised in captivity and are now 4 or 5 years old, were released on San Fe Island.  A team of specialists transported the tortoises from Santa Cruz and reported they were looking for shade and starting to feed.

San Francisco Plaza – Vehicular traffic will be suspended on Padre Aguirre between Jaramillo and Córdova while the plaza is being remodeled.  <Actually I like the rickety old market.  It’s not quite old enough to be of historical or architectural interest.>   Merchants will be relocated to Padre Aguirre.  Temporary booths are being built and no date has been given for the move although construction is supposed to start the 2nd week in May. <Sounds like another Tranvía.  Normally you clear the site on which you will be working before you start.  Maybe they intend to start demolition whether or not the vendors have vacated.>
